MySQL数据库修改字段编码可以通过ALTER TABLE语句来实现。具体步骤如下:
- 首先,使用ALTER TABLE语句修改表结构,将需要修改编码的字段类型更改为BLOB或TEXT类型,以确保不会丢失数据。例如,将VARCHAR字段修改为LONGTEXT。
- 首先,使用ALTER TABLE语句修改表结构,将需要修改编码的字段类型更改为BLOB或TEXT类型,以确保不会丢失数据。例如,将VARCHAR字段修改为LONGTEXT。
- 然后,使用ALTER TABLE语句再次修改表结构,将字段类型修改回原来的类型,并设置新的字符编码。例如,将之前修改过的字段类型修改回VARCHAR并设置为UTF-8编码。
- 然后,使用ALTER TABLE语句再次修改表结构,将字段类型修改回原来的类型,并设置新的字符编码。例如,将之前修改过的字段类型修改回VARCHAR并设置为UTF-8编码。
- 如果想要修改整个表的编码,可以使用以下语句:
- 如果想要修改整个表的编码,可以使用以下语句:
- 这将修改表中所有字段的编码为UTF-8。
- 为了确保修改成功,可以使用SHOW CREATE TABLE语句来查看表结构和编码是否已经修改成功。
- 为了确保修改成功,可以使用SHOW CREATE TABLE语句来查看表结构和编码是否已经修改成功。
- 这将显示表的创建语句,可以确认字段的编码已经修改成功。
修改字段编码的好处包括:
- 支持多种语言和字符集,使数据库能够存储和处理不同语言的数据。
- 提高数据的存储效率和查询性能。
- 避免乱码和字符转换的问题。
MySQL提供了一些相关的产品和服务,可以帮助进行数据库管理和优化,例如:
这些产品提供了一系列的功能和工具,帮助用户轻松管理和优化MySQL数据库。